Title 8 Section 1235 of the U.S. Code, Improper Entry by Alien, Any citizen of any country other than
the United States who: Enters or attempts to enter the United States at any time or place other than as
designated by immigration officers; or Eludes examination or inspection by immigration officers; or Attempts
to enter or obtains entry to the United States by a willfully false or misleading representation or the willful
concealment of a material fact; has committed a federal crime.
